Commit f643d15e authored by Daniel Silveira's avatar Daniel Silveira Committed by Luis Murta

Update with sucess message.

Update, typo error
Update, no longer kill tee
Fixes outdated arm_core_context memory footprint

Error was obfuscated using the arm-none-eabi-gcc due to the packaging of
3 4bit enums into a single word. workspace alloc was overflowing when
4bit values were (also correct) stored as 32bit.
parent a83ebb09
......@@ -23,7 +23,7 @@ class ARMConfiguration(object):
CPU_CORE_CONTROL = [ 0x8, 0x24]
CPU_CORE_CONTEXT = [ 0x8, 0x90]
CPU_CORE_CONTEXT = [ 0x8, 0x98]
CPU_CORE_CONTEXT_STACK = [ 0x8, 0x240] # 8x isf (0x48 each)
CPU_CORE_CONTEXT_FPU = [ 0x8, 0x108]
CPU_CORE_CONTEXT_HM = [ 0x8, 0x10]
sleep 5
killall qemu-system-arm
killall tee
......@@ -13,6 +13,7 @@ with open("testresult.txt",'r') as f:
text =
# f.close()
print text
error_list = ["FAILURE DETECTED","HM error detected"]
test_ok = True
......@@ -20,6 +21,10 @@ for word in error_list:
for item in text.split("\n"):
if word in item:
test_ok = False
if (word == error_list[0]):
sys.stderr.write("Unit Test Failure\n")
if(test_ok == False):
sys.stderr.write("FAILURE DETECTED")
print ("Test has PASSED with no errors\n")
